http://www.al.com/auburnfootball/index.ssf/2014/08/auburn_practice_report_starter.html (http://www.al.com/auburnfootball/index.ssf/2014/08/auburn_practice_report_starter.html)
Quote
AUBURN, Alabama -- A projected starter along Auburn's offensive line is not expected to participate in full-contact practice today.

Offensive guard Chad Slade was off to the side and not wearing shoulder pads during a session of practice open to the media.

Slade is expected to start at left guard for the Tigers in the season opener against Arkansas after Alex Kozan had season-ending back surgery in July.

A few more updates from practice today:

*** Senior cornerback Trovon Reed was not practicing and was off to the side. He had a small brace on his right knee, but it doesn't appear to be serious.

*** Offensive tackle Austin Golson, who must sit out this season after transferring from Ole Miss, was off to the side without shoulder pads. He did not practice Monday.

*** Receiver Dominic Walker was dressed out, but was running the sidelines during drills.

*** We finally got see freshman running back Roc Thomas touch the football today. Thomas was involved in the kick return rotation alongside Ricardo Louis, Corey Grant, Johnathan Ford and Stanton Truitt.

*** The same rotation at punt return was working special teams today.

*** Several referee from the Alabama High School Athletic Association arrived at practice at reporters were departing. It appears Auburn will work some scrimmage-like situations.

http://www.al.com/auburnfootball/index.ssf/2014/08/auburn_h-back_injured_availabi.html (http://www.al.com/auburnfootball/index.ssf/2014/08/auburn_h-back_injured_availabi.html)
Quote
Auburn H-Back injured; availability for season up in air

By Brandon Marcello
August 12, 2014 at 12:27 PM

AUBURN, Alabama -- Auburn fullback Gage Batten has been injured, and his status for the upcoming season is in doubt.

Auburn coach Gus Malzahn confirmed Batten has been injured, but did not divulge details or the severity of the injury Tuesday.

"He's a tough guy," Malzahn said. "He's a team player, he's a hard working guy, brings a lot of edge to our team."

Batten's injury affects Auburn's plans at H-Back, where Brandon Fulse and C.J. Uzomah are expected to challenge for the starting job. Batten, a walk-on, is a backup.

Tight ends coach Scott Fountain said last week Batten had the potential to be the go-to lead blocker in third-and-short situations.
